Abstract

District Klaten has many springs that are used by people for many things; one of them used for tourist attractions is umbul tourism. It is difficult to use K-Means Clustering Method for determine umbul tourism according to classification and spread in district Klaten. K-Means Clustering is a method of grouping data by taking parameters of a number clusters, and partitioning data into clusters, based on similarities between data in one cluster and dissimilarities between different clusters, the center of the cluster is the average of the cluster member values it called as centroid. The results of this study are grouping the umbul truism which are divided into three clusters namely Enough, Good and The Best. The result of the data, there are 4 umbul tourisms in the first cluster is Beautiful category, namely Tirtomoyo, Buto, Pancuran, and Besuki. In the third cluster of umbul tourism has good category, namely Tirto Mulyani umbul, Gedaren, Sumber Nila, Manten, Sigedang, and Kajen. In the best category in the second cluster has 8 umbul tourisms, namely Nila umbul, Tirto Mulyono, Ingas, Lumban Tirto, Ponggok, Tirto Raharjo, Jolotundo, and Tirtomulyono.Keywords: K-Means Clustering, Umbul, Umbul Category, Tourist Destination

Abstract

Poverty is a multidimensional and multisector problem that concerns human dignity. Therefore, poverty alleviation efforts must be implemented in a comprehensive and integrated manner. This research was conducted to find out the influence of Gross Regional Domestic Product (GRDP), regional spending and education on the poverty level of Jember Regency in 2011 to 2020, both partially and simultaneously. The data used by researchers is secondary data obtained from the Jember Regency Central Statistics Agency (BPS) website and the Directorate General of Financial Balance (DJPK) of the Ministry of Finance of the Republic of Indonesia. This quantitative research method uses multiple linear regression analysis with the Ordinary Least Square (OLS) model and is assisted by the SPSS application. The research results show that GRDP and education partially have no effect on the poverty level of Jember Regency, while regional spending has a negative and significant effect on the poverty level of Jember Regency. However, simultaneously, all independent variables have a significant effect on the poverty level of Jember Regency.

Abstract

The aim of this research is to overcome the problem of mental retardation in developing mathematical potential and talent, especially abilities in social arithmetic by providing learning media adapted to the characteristics of mentally retarded students in the form of 3D comics with Indonesian cultural nuances based Technology Pedagogical Content Knowledge (TPACK) assisted by money pyramid media. This is because 11 of the 13 students are still not familiar with the new currency issued by Bank Indonesia, making it difficult for them to spend money. 3D comic media contains stories about traveling to three places in the archipelago which include Bali, Yogyakarta and Bogor, the embossed effect on the paper gives a three-dimensional impression so that it attracts the attention of mentally retarded students to learn using 3D Comics. The money pyramid media is used as the initial foundation for introducing money from one thousand to one hundred thousand denominations to mentally retarded students. The subjects in this research were 13 mentally retarded students in class X C using research methods in the form of experiments. Based on the results of research conducted using data processing, it was found that there were differences in the learning outcomes of mentally retarded students before and after being given treatment in the form of using 3D comic media with nuances of Indonesian culture and money pyramids. The amount of effectiveness in using media influences the learning outcomes of mentally retarded students by 67% in the quite effective category.
